Nuvation Bio Inc.

1.75
-0.01 (-0.57%)
At close: Apr 01, 2025, 3:59 PM
1.75
-0.22%
After-hours: Apr 01, 2025, 08:00 PM EDT

Price Reaction to Earnings Reports

No data available